WebFeb 5, 2015 · StreamReader will dispose the underlying Stream when disposed. Move the dispose and close of sr until after the write to the response stream. WebAccepted answer The call to your service is never awaited, so it is kind of became fire-and-forget which means the request might ends before the service finishes its job which would cause the requested services to get disposed.
